‘404 object not found’ is the message that we see when the file is not found in server. Iris Dressler and Hans D. Christ take this message for the international congress regarding data/media art preservation, presentation and archiving. Many specialists from abroad were invited, and they examine several case studies and research project. Nathalie Boseul SHIN asked initiators to invite ‘404 project’ to Seoul in 2006. With great collaborations with Total Museum of Contemporary Art, ‘404 project Seoul’ was possible. Basically ‘404 project Seoul’ in 2006 started on the result of 2003 international congress. ‘404 project Seoul’ is constituted of Research project, exhibition and international symposium. It had great success. The most important outcomes from ‘404 project Seoul’ in 2006 was from the research project which had regular meeting and translate the presentation text in 2003 congress. Based on this, research team had interviewed with people who works at the media field in Korea. That interview project gave us to opportunity to look back and re-thinking about media art scene in Korea, Now. The last thing research project team did was to restore closed but important web projects.
‘404 project Seoul’ in 2007 is focus on more specialized workshop with people who works at the media art filed such as curator, artists and also have interested in this area like student. ‘404 project Seoul’ invite Steve Dietz from Zero One Festival, USA and Sylvie Lacert from DOCAM, Daniel Langlois Foundation, Canada as our special lecturer. In addition to this, curators and archivists are also invited to workshop to share the idea and discuss about this issue, data/media art preservation, presentation, and archive.
With this precious opportunities, ‘404 project Seoul’ expects to make a new platform toward much more secured and free space.
